Regular price €19.00 Price €9.00
New arrivals - Page 191
New arrivals
Showing 2281-2292 of 2462 item(s)
Active filters
Price €2.50
Price €1.67
Price €2.50
Price €3.33
Price €3.33
Price €3.33
Price €2.50
Showing 2281-2292 of 2462 item(s)